From Handke to Pron: intergenerational traumas and narrative breakdowns
El espíritu de mis padres sigue subiendo en la lluvia, a novel published by Patricio Pron in 2011, is closely related to Peter Handke's Desgracia indeseada [1972]. In both cases, the narrators try to reconstruct their parents' lives and thus progress in the discovery of their own identity....

El espíritu de mis padres sigue subiendo en la lluvia, novela publicada por Patricio Pron en 2011, establece estrechas relaciones con Desgracia indeseada, de Peter Handke (1972). En ambos casos, los narradores intentan reconstruir la vida de sus padres y así progresar en el descubrimiento de la propia identidad. Proponemos leer ambas obras de forma comparada, atendiendo a la ruptura que operan en la lógica narrativa del lenguaje y a las proyecciones que realizan desde la historia familiar hacia la historia nacional. Los dos aspectos del análisis resultan complementarios: el resultado es una presentación fragmentaria del territorio desde el que los autores escriben y a la vez una reflexión sobre lo traumático en la escritura.
